How Matcha Ice Batches Are Checked
Inspection is only useful if the result is recorded somewhere you can find it later. A matcha ice batch log with weights, codes and measurements turns a future complaint into a five minute lookup.

How Matcha Ice Fits the Assortment
Before anything else, decide which customer you are buying matcha ice for. A convenience counter with limited shelf depth needs a tight range that turns quickly, while a specialist shop can carry a deeper ladder of options and educate buyers into higher ticket lines.
Category data for matcha ice is noisier than it looks. Promotions, weather and local competition all move weekly numbers, so read three months at a time rather than reacting to a single week.
What to Fix Before Approving Matcha Ice
Two specifications that matter more than buyers expect: the seal integrity after a drop test and the consistency of the draw from first use to last. Both are measurable before you commit to volume.
Where possible, tie part of the matcha ice payment to inspection against the written spec. It focuses attention on the numbers rather than on the relationship.

Turning Matcha Ice Into Repeats
Online, the listing for matcha ice should answer three questions without scrolling: what it is, how strong it is, and what it tastes like. Everything else belongs further down the page.
Staff knowledge moves matcha ice more than any fixture. A two minute explanation of the difference between this line and the one next to it converts a browsing shopper into a repeat buyer far more reliably than a discount.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I mix strengths in one order?
In most cases yes, as long as each strength meets the minimum run length. Mixed strength cartons are popular with retailers building their first display because they show the full ladder without over committing.
How do you handle a short shipment?
Cartons are counted and weighed before dispatch and the figures are shared with you. If something is short on arrival, the packing record and the carrier documentation are both available, which keeps the claim straightforward.
What is the usual minimum order for matcha ice?
For a standard production run the minimum is normally one master carton per flavour, though mixed cartons can be arranged for a first order. If you are testing the line, ask about a sample pack first and treat the freight as part of your research budget.
How should matcha ice be stored?
Cool, dry and out of direct sunlight. Heat and light are the two things that shorten shelf life fastest. Rotate stock by batch code rather than by arrival date, and keep cartons off concrete floors in humid warehouses.
